Search San Francisco Business Directory

1900 Folsom St San Francisco CA 94103
(415) 252-0306
476 Castro St San Francisco CA 94117
(415) 558-0893
4149 18th St San Francisco CA 94114
(415) 863-4027
401 Castro St Sf CA 94114
(415) 864-9470
1369 Folsom St San Francisco CA 94103
(415) 431-4695
4146 18th St San Francisco CA 94114
(415) 621-2811
225 Church St San Francisco CA 94114
(415) 621-7058
133 Turk St Sf CA 94102
(415) 441-2922
1347 Folsom St San Francisco CA 94103
(415) 552-8689
440 Castro St San Francisco CA 94114
(415) 621-8732

Are we missing something? Add business listings for free!

Add A Business